The short version

A single MCP stdio endpoint with 51 tools for iOS (simulator + real) and Android device control, native UI automation, end-to-end flows, trustworthy assertions, React Native debugging, WebView DOM + network inspection, and a no-vision canvas/WebGL brain for Pixi/Konva/Fabric/Phaser/Three/Babylon (validated live in WebKit) — plus an experimental engine bridge for instrumented Unity/GL builds (AltTester) — one connection instead of half a dozen servers.

  • a single execFile-based command runner (no shell — arguments are passed verbatim),
  • consistent structured errors (a tool never crashes the server),
  • automatic retry around Maestro's known iOS-driver flakiness,
  • graceful degradation when a toolchain (e.g. adb) is absent,
  • evidenced verdicts — so an agent knows when a flow actually worked

What it needs from you

Configuration is passed through the environment: BUNDLE_ID, PODIUM_WDA_URL. Treat anything key-shaped as a real credential — scope it to the minimum the server needs, and rotate it if it ever lands in a shared config.

  • macOS with Xcode command-line tools (xcrun, simctl) - Node.js ≥ 22 (uses native fetch and WebSocket; .npmrc sets engine-strict=true) - mobilecli — bundled automatically as an npm dependency; the default native gesture + WebView backend (no separate install) - (optional) idb (idb + idb_companion) — preferred native gesture backend when

How to install the Podium MCP server

{
  "mcpServers": {
    "podium": { "command": "npx", "args": ["-y", "podium-mcp"] }
  }
}

Configuration as documented by the project. Restart the client after saving.
